'One Piece: Heroines' Sets Its Premiere Date

A new anime inspired by one of the spin-offs of Eiichiro Oda’s legendary One Piece manga is currently in production. The upcoming TV series, based on the light novel collection One Piece: Heroines, now has an official premiere date. The adaptation will debut on July 5, as announced on the official One Piece website.

The anime will be directed by Haruka Katamani, known for Doremi: Looking for Magic, with Momoka Toyoda writing the script. Toyoda previously worked on My Happy Marriage and One Piece: A Letter from a Fan, both of which showcased her strong storytelling and sensitivity to character-driven narratives.

One Piece: Heroines currently consists of two volumes. The first was published in 2021, and the second arrived in 2024. These books compile stories centered on beloved female characters from Oda’s universe, giving them a chance to shine outside the main adventure. Readers can expect an intimate look into their personalities, motivations, and struggles.

The first volume includes unique tales about Nami, Robin, Vivi, and Perona. Nami steps into the glamorous but cutthroat world of fashion, discovering how courage and self-belief can shape destiny. Robin delves into an ancient mystery as she works to decipher an archaeological relic, blending intellect with quiet strength. Vivi experiences a heartfelt story of unexpected romance when she receives a mysterious love letter. Perona, on the other hand, finds herself caught in an unusual and supernatural conflict that tests her spirit and resolve.

Since its debut in Weekly Shonen Jump in July 1997, Oda’s One Piece has become the best-selling manga of all time, with over 516 million copies in circulation worldwide. Its enduring appeal comes from its blend of adventure, humor, and emotional storytelling, which continues to attract both long-time fans and new readers alike.

The One Piece franchise has expanded far beyond manga. It now includes movies, video games, spin-offs, and live-action adaptations. On March 10, Netflix will premiere the second season of its live-action One Piece series. Additionally, the streaming platform is working on an anime remake, which promises to reimagine the beloved saga for a new generation of viewers.
